24 Events Broadcast on ESPN 360/BluffMagazine.com

So after a lot of confusion/anger(some people) around the net, it has been released that there will be 24 events, almost half, broadcast on the internet via ESPN360(if it is available to you) and BluffMagazine.com. Not all of the events are on both sites, so the people who do not get ESPN360 don't get to watch all of them live, but I am sure someone will find another outlet. We knew that they were going to be broadcasting them online, but we were waiting to see which events they were going to show and they finally released them.

Event---------------------------------------Date--------Outlet
Event 4: $1,000 no-limit hold'em----------June 2-----ESPN360.com
Event 5: $1,500 pot-limit Omaha----------June 3-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 7: $1,500 no-limit hold'em----------June 4-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 10: $2,500 PL Omaha/PL hold'em---June 5-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 11: $2,000 no-limit hold'em---------June 6-----ESPN360.com
Event 15: $5,000 no-limit hold'em 6Max---June 8-----ESPN360.com
Event 17: $1,000 no-limit women hold'em-June 9-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 19: $2,500 no-limit hold'em 6Max---June 10 -----ESPN360.com
Event 20: $1,500 pot-limit hold 'em-------June 11-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 22: $1,500 no-limit hold'em shoot--June 12-----ESPN360.com
Event 24: $1,500 no-limit hold'em---------June 13-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 29: $10,000 no-limit heads-up------June 15-----ESPN360.com
Event 30: $2,500 pot-limit Omaha---------June 16-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 33: $10,000 limit hold'em-----------June 17-----ESPN360.com
Event 34: $1,500 no-limit hold'em---------June 18-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 35: $5,000 pot-limit hold'em--------June 19-----ESPN360.com
Event 36: $2,000 no-limit hold'em---------June 20-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 40: $10,000 pot-limit Omaha--------June 22-----ESPN360.com
Event 41: $5,000 no-limit hold'em shoot--June 23-----ESPN360.com
Event 45: $10,000 pot-limit hold'em-------June 25-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 47: $2,500 mixed hold'em-----------June 26-----ESPN360.com
Event 51: $1,500 no-limit hold'em---------June 29-----Bluffmagazine.com
Event 49: $50,000 HORSE------------------June 30-----ESPN360.com
Event 54: $1,500 no-limit hold'em---------July 1-----Bluffmagazine.com
